從2022年4月25日開始就是新版本的SDK來構(gòu)建
,蘋果于當(dāng)?shù)貢r間周二向開發(fā)者們發(fā)出提醒:向 App Store 提交應(yīng)用程序的要求即將發(fā)生改變從 2022 年 4 月 25 日開始,所有為蘋果旗下平臺創(chuàng)建的 App 必須使用 Xcode 13,也就是最新版本的 SDK 來構(gòu)建

蘋果表示,Xcode 13 包括其操作系統(tǒng)的最新版本的 SDK,其中包括 iOS 15,iPadOS 15,watchOS 8 和 macOS Monterey這樣一來,蘋果將只接受與最新版本 iOS,macOS 等系統(tǒng)兼容的新應(yīng)用
也就是說,開發(fā)人員下個月必須使用 Xcode 13 去開發(fā)他們的應(yīng)用,并將支持 iOS 15 和 macOS Monterey 帶來的新 API,包括 SwiftUI,ARKit 5,Safari Extensions for iOS,ShazamKit 和 SharePlay 等。
充分利用 iOS15,iPadOS15 和 watchOS8 中令人激動的功能,提供更加直觀和有價值的用戶體驗通過重構(gòu)代碼以利用 Swift 中的異步函數(shù),提高你的應(yīng)用程序的性能而伴隨著 SwiftUI 的最新更新,你可以用新的功能來增強你的應(yīng)用程序,如改進的列表視圖,更好的搜索體驗,以及對控制重點區(qū)域的支持
值得注意的是,雖然新開發(fā)的 App 必須用最新版本的 Xcode 構(gòu)建,但它們?nèi)匀豢芍С痔O果的舊版本操作系統(tǒng),如 iOS 14 和 macOS Big Sur。IT之家獲悉,根據(jù)開發(fā)者論壇上的帖子,從MacAppStore更新到Xcode12會導(dǎo)致項目不能編譯,出現(xiàn)打包錯誤。“內(nèi)部錯誤:缺少PackageDescriptionModule”,目前似乎還沒有修復(fù)。。
本站提醒,更多詳細信息請查閱Apple Developer 網(wǎng)站。許多開發(fā)者都看到了以下信息。
。聲明:本網(wǎng)轉(zhuǎn)發(fā)此文章,旨在為讀者提供更多信息資訊,所涉內(nèi)容不構(gòu)成投資、消費建議。文章事實如有疑問,請與有關(guān)方核實,文章觀點非本網(wǎng)觀點,僅供讀者參考。